Hardware Specifications & Performance
The NS 10Gbps SFP Modules deliver industry-leading reach and robustness:
Model | Media Type | Wavelength | Max Reach | Connector | Data Rate |
SFP-10G-SR | Multi-Mode Fiber | 850 nm | 400 m @ OM3 / 300 m @ OM2 | LC Duplex | 1.25–10.31 Gbps |
SFP-10G-LR | Single-Mode Fiber | 1310 nm | 10 km @ G.652 SMF | LC Duplex | 1.25–10.31 Gbps |
SFP-10G-TX | Copper (Twisted Pair) | N/A | 30 m @ Cat6a/Cat7 | RJ45 Port | 10 GbE, 1 GbE |
- SFP-10G-SR: Optimized for short-haul, high-density connections within data-center pods and wiring closets.
- SFP-10G-LR: Ideal for campus backbones and campus-to-data-center links.
- SFP-10G-TX: Offers cost-effective copper uplinks where fiber installation is impractical.
Each module consumes under 1 W in typical operation, significantly less than 10GBase-T optics, which often draw 2 to 5 W. Ruggedized options rated for 0 °C to 70 °C (and industrial versions to –40 °C) are available to tackle extended environmental demands.

Installation & Diagnostics
Despite their generic module nature, NS SFP+ transceivers fully support standard diagnostics:
- Digital Diagnostics Monitoring (DDM/DOM) via SFF-8472 for real-time optical and electrical metrics
- Live Hot-Swap: Insert or remove modules without shutting down ports
- LED Link/Activity: On NS switches, port LEDs auto-reflect TX/RX status with any SFP+ module
Sample CLI (Cisco IOS) for SR Module Verification
Switch#
show interfaces transceiver details gigabitEthernet1/1/1
Transceiver is present
Type: SFP-10G-SR
Connector: LC
Encoding: 64b66b
Nominal bitrate: 10312 Mbit/s
Wavelength: 850 nm
Manufacturer: NS Networks
Temperature: 35.7 C
Voltage: 3.31 V
Current TX: 5.2 mA
Optical TX power: -1.2 dBm
Optical RX power: -6.4 dBm
Switch#
Use similar commands on Huawei (display transceiver interface) or Juniper (show interfaces diagnostics optics) to confirm module health.
